How To Choose The Best Coding Bootcamp?

1. Check Curriculum

Look for a comprehensive and up-to-date curriculum that covers the most sought-after programming languages, frameworks, and tools.

2. Type of Training

Some bootcamps emphasize project-based learning, while others focus more on lectures and theory. It is better to choose that offers practical hands-on experience.

3. Job Placement Support

Search for the bootcamp's candidate outcomes and employment rates. Check the types of companies they work for and the average salaries. Also, inquire about the job support.

4. Technical Competency of the Trainers

Check the qualifications and experience of the bootcamp's instructors. Research if they have real-world industry experience and teaching expertise.

5. Cost and Financing Options

Look for financing options or income-sharing agreements (ISAs) to help make the bootcamp more affordable. Also, look for any hidden terms and conditions.

6. Trainer to Trainees Ratio

Consider the level of personalized support offered by the bootcamp. Small class sizes, one-on-one mentorship, & access to teaching assistants can enhance your learning experience.
